Starting Point and Convenience

The tour kicks off with pick-up options at around 28 locations across the southern resorts of Gran Canaria, from Playa del Inglés to Puerto Rico. This extensive list makes it pretty convenient to hop on without having to arrange separate transport, which is a plus when you’re on vacation. The transfer is on a van, typically around 30 minutes, giving you time to relax before the boat trip begins.

The Catamaran: Modern Comfort on the Water

The boat itself is brand new, spacious, and sleek, designed to provide maximum comfort. It features a floating solarium—a perfect spot to soak up the sun while the sea breeze cools you down. Several reviews call it “luxury” and “extremely comfortable,” emphasizing how well-maintained and modern it is. The crew takes pride in keeping everything spotless, which adds to the overall feeling of quality.

The Itinerary: Unspoiled Beaches and Natural Beauty

The trip departs from Puerto Rico and heads toward Veneguera or Tiritaña, beaches that are known for their tranquility and natural charm. These spots are far from the crowds, offering a peaceful setting for swimming, snorkeling, or simply relaxing on deck. The 4-hour cruise is designed to give ample time for enjoyment without feeling rushed, and the stops are carefully chosen for their scenic appeal.

Snorkeling and Swimming

Included in the package are goggles and snorkels—a thoughtful touch for those wanting to explore underwater. The reviews describe snorkeling as “fantastic,” with visitors enjoying the chance to see marine life in clear waters. If you’re prone to seasickness, you might want to bring some medication, but generally, the gentle cruise and calm waters tend to suit most.

Food and Drinks: A Feast at Sea

The all-inclusive aspect really shines here. You’ll be served a delicious meal, with options like paella, salad, papas arrugadas with mojo, and seasonal fruit. The drinks are unlimited throughout the trip, including beer, cava, soft drinks, and water—a real bonus for keeping everyone refreshed.

Guests have raved about the food, describing it as “freshly prepared” and “really delicious.” One reviewer called the food “an absolute delight,” highlighting the care put into presentation and flavor. How long is the tour?
The cruise lasts about four hours, from departure to return, with stops at unspoiled beaches for swimming and snorkeling.

What is included in the price?
The all-inclusive package covers boat transportation, food (paella, salad, papas arrugadas, seasonal fruit), drinks (beer, cava, soft drinks, water), snorkeling gear, and crew service.

Are there pickup options?
Yes, the tour offers pickup at around 28 locations across the south of Gran Canaria, making it convenient to start your day without additional planning.

What should I bring?
Pack swimwear, a towel, something warm for the breeze, a hat, and sunscreen to stay comfortable and protected during the trip.
